How much do post office carrier j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for post office carrier in the United States is $20.29,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$23.08 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a post office carrier do?

A Post Office Carrier, also known as a mail carrier or letter carrier, is responsible for delivering mail and packages to homes and businesses along a designated route. They sort mail at the post office, load it into their vehicle or mailbag, and ensure that it is delivered accurately and on time. In addition to delivering mail, carriers may also collect outgoing mail, obtain signatures for certain deliveries, and answer customer questions about postal services. The job often requires walking or driving long distances and working in various weather conditions. Attention to detail, reliability, and physical stamina are important qualities for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a post office carrier,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Post Office Carrier, you need physical stamina, attention to detail, a valid driver's license, and knowledge of postal regulations. Familiarity with handheld scanners, route management software, and mail sorting equipment is common in this role. Excellent time management, customer service, and reliability are soft skills that set top performers apart. These abilities ensure timely, accurate mail delivery and foster trust with customers and the postal service.

What are some common challenges faced by post office carriers, and how can they be managed?

Post Office Carriers often encounter challenges such as working in various weather conditions, managing heavy or bulky mail loads, and adhering to tight delivery schedules. Effective time management and route planning can help carriers stay on track and ensure timely deliveries. Additionally, staying physically fit and using proper lifting techniques can prevent injuries. Carriers also benefit from strong communication skills to interact with customers and address delivery issues professionally.

How to get a job as a post office carrier?

To become a post office carrier, applicants typically need to meet age and background requirements, pass a postal exam, and complete a background check. Prior experience with driving and customer service can be beneficial, and candidates often need a valid driver's license and good physical condition for delivering mail on foot or by vehicle.

What disqualifies you from being a post office carrier?

Disqualifications for a post office carrier typically include a criminal record, especially for serious offenses, a poor driving record, or inability to pass a background check. Additionally, candidates must have a valid driver's license, good physical health, and the ability to lift and carry mail and packages regularly.
